About this image

This nebula is a favourite subject. It has taken three years of short summer nights to accumulate 16.5 hours of total integration used to create this image. Recent developments in PixInsight, particularly the Multiscale All Sky Reference (MARS) database for accurate light gradient correction of Ha and Oiii data, has enabled the precise visualisation of the faint Oiii signal that appears to encircle the Ha of NGC6888.

In this image, the stars have been spectrophotometrically colour calibrated, while the nebulosity is shown with an HO-Forax palette.
